California AB 1481 (20112012) — Public safety.

Existing law requires each party demanding a jury trial to deposit advance jury fees in the amount of $150 with the clerk or judge. Existing law requires the court to transmit the advance jury fees to the State Treasury for deposit in the Trial Court Trust Fund within 45 calendar days after the end of the month in which the advance jury fees are deposited with the court.
